 With the Support and on Behalf of its Membership in 2010 the Chamber: • Worked to ensure a pro-business environment, partnering with a variety of coalitions to strengthen advocacy effort. • Weighed in on numerous pieces of state and federal legislation, regulations, and ballot propositions supporting the efforts of business as the driver of our local economy. • Added an International Business and Trade Committee to efforts to support business • Cosponsored the Kern Economic Summit, Energy & Clean Air Expo, 13th Biennial Oil & Gas Conference and 14th Annual SHRM Symposium & Expo. • Brought high level business training to members with expert speakers/trainers, Patrick Lencioni and David Aaker. • Promoted business by bringing several thousand members and community partners together for networking opportunities through events such as the Business & Technology Expo, Business After Hours Trade Shows, Mixers and Summer Social. • Collaborated on a variety of educational programs and academies designed to help graduate “work ready” students. • Made thousands of referrals to Chamber members in response to inquiries for products and services. • Logged thousands of visitors to the Chamber’s website and expanded marketing presence to include Facebook and Twitter as a venue to promote our Chamber and our members. • Conducted more than 180 committee and task force meetings to plan and execute Chamber member driven programs and opened our conference rooms over 200 times for our members to conduct their meetings and activities at the Chamber. • Celebrated numerous ground breakings, grand openings and milestones for member businesses. • Strengthened the Chamber and the business community with the addition of over 190 new members businesses. • And much, much, more.
